India, Mumbai, August 29, 2009: Tata Consultancy Services (TCS), a leading IT services, business solutions and outsourcing firm, today announced that it had signed a contract with Saudi Arabia’s Chamber of Commerce of the Eastern Region for executing an Oracle ERP implementation project.
The Chamber of Commerce of the Eastern Region is one of Saudi Arabia's oldest and well-established service organizations which are devoted to the cause of promotion of the private sector's contribution to the Saudi economy. It provides various services to the local community and businesses to facilitate their interaction with the government with the ultimate objective of accelerating the pace of growth in the Saudi Arabian economy.
In order to meet its objective, the Chamber has embarked upon a transformational IT initiative to automate business processes in order to provide online web-based services to its customers. This transformation exercise would result in improved efficiency and quality; thereby changing the way services are delivered. The project covers the Chamber’s process and services including finance, logistics, budgeting, human resource management, customer and citizen relationship management as well as project management and a business portal.
The agreement was signed by Abdulrahman Al Rashed, Chairman of the Easter Region Chamber of Commerce and Neeraj K Srivastava, Country Manager, TCS Saudi Arabia, in the presence of eminent attendees. The project will be completed within a period of two and half years in three phases ending in 2010.
Abdulrahman Al Rashed said that the Electronic Chamber Project will enable the investors and researchers to obtain the relevant economic data from the rich database maintained by the Chamber pertaining to the various industry sectors in the Eastern Region. In addition to that the project will extend the communication channels between the Chamber, its subscribers, investors and researchers of the industry.
In continuation of the same, Adnan Al Na'eim, General Secretary of the Eastern Region Chamber of Commerce said that the project is considered a qualitative jump and precedent in the Gulf region and Arab World in the area of subscriber service. The project will contribute in raising the level of service provided by the Eastern Region Chamber of Commerce to its subscribers to a higher level with unmatched professionalism and ease of usage. He added that the implementation of the latest version of the Enterprise Resources Planning (ERP) software of the Oracle Corporation will also enhance its operations related to financial, logistical, human resources, customer relations management and project management functions.
